
The Cobb County Branch of the NAACP is gearing up for two days of Juneteenth celebrations this weekend at Glover Park.
Juneteenth commemorates June 19, 1865, the day that slaves in Texas learned of the signing of the Emancipation Proclamation.Â
In recent years, other parts of the country have embraced the day and held their own events.
